ABOUT THE FILM

„After the end of war you start paying the price for war.“

The Lebanese civil war came to an end ten years ago. For 17 years, between 1975 and 1992, it defined daily reality for the Lebanese people. This film does not focus on blood and violence, but their unseen shadows touch every picture, every wish, every attempt to understand.

VOICES OF(F) – BEIRUT presents the thoughts and feelings of five members of the Lebanese war-generation who speak frankly about life, in what was once one of the most war-torn places on earth. Today, the past of Beirut and the present of the war-generation in Lebanon seems destined to become the future of Baghdad, Gaza or Riyad – and its people.
